For those of you not familiar with whimsies, I will explain. In every box of Red Rose Tea bags, there is a small ceramic collectable enclosed. They are released in series....right now the "Pet Shop" collection is out.

While I have always been an avid tea drinker, I haven't always collected these. When I moved in with hubby, my MIL introduced me to Red Rose Tea Bags. It had a great taste to it and I was instanly hooked. A little while after that I found out about the Whimsies. I fell in love with them as well and started saving them and every time we got a box of tea it was a treat because I would get a new figurine.
